Installation Procedure

1. Inspect the groove and mating surfaces for cleanliness and damage. 2. Lightly lubricate the O-ring and groove with a compatible lubricant. 3. Carefully install the O-ring, ensuring it is seated evenly within the groove without twisting.

Common Mistakes & How to Avoid Them

❌ Mistake✅ Correct Approach
Installing a dry O-ring, leading to increased friction and potential tearing.Always use a compatible lubricant to ease installation and prevent damage.
Twisting or stretching the O-ring during installation, compromising its sealing capability.Gently place the O-ring into the groove, ensuring it lies flat and un-twisted.

⚠️ Engineering Warnings

  • Ensure material compatibility with the specific fluid or gas being sealed.
  • Avoid exposure to excessive UV radiation or ozone, which can degrade Viton over time.
